Full Speed Ahead                                                                 20th June 2007


This week Flybrid Systems are celebrating the first full speed runs of their flywheel spin test rig. The rig, which was designed and built by Flybrid Systems engineers, reached 65,000 RPM and ran in total for more than 2 hours.

The tests completed so far demonstrate what the company believe is the highest speed hermetic vacuum shaft seal in the world. Throughout all the testing so far absolutely no leakage of air into the flywheel chamber has been experienced. The seal is of a novel design and patent protection has been applied for.

Testing will continue over the coming weeks to build up information on the system life and to evaluate the effect on friction of several different bearing and seal arrangements.
